Liam Gallagher and John Squire release their debut album on March 1st.

Liam Gallagher and John Squire have shared the video for their recent single Mars To Liverpool.

It’s out with the pair’s maiden tour of Europe all sold-out as the partnership which was officially unveiled at the start of this year continues to gain momentum.




“It was really inspiring to have those Knebworth gigs fresh in my mind as I started writing,” Squire has reflected.

Then it was a case of trying to steer it away from all being too rocky, and trying to mix up the sentiments as well. I like the way that in some parts, it’s quite melancholic and it can make you well up, but there are other parts that are kind of irreverent, rude or crude.

“There’s a little bit of everything in there, I think it’s a really good mix. I had a hunch that we’d sound good together, but I wasn’t prepared for it to be such a good fit.”
